The next commit is going to remove init_proc_e200(), which is one of
the two calling sites of register_BookE206_sprs(). This causes recent
versions of GCC to inline the register_BookE206_sprs() function into
the other only remaining calling site, init_proc_e500(), which in
turn causes some false-positives compiler warnings:
In file included from ../../devel/qemu/target/ppc/cpu_init.c:46:
In function ‘register_BookE206_sprs’,
inlined from ‘init_proc_e500’ at
../../devel/qemu/target/ppc/cpu_init.c:2910:5:
../../devel/qemu/target/ppc/cpu_init.c:897:29: error:
array subscript 3 is outside array bounds of ‘uint32_t[2]’ {aka ‘unsigned
int[2]’}
[-Werror=array-bounds=]
897 | tlbncfg[3]);
| ~~~~~~~^~~
../../devel/qemu/target/ppc/spr_common.h:61:39: note: in definition of macro
‘spr_register_kvm_hv’
61 | KVM_ARG(one_reg_id) initial_value)
| ^~~~~~~~~~~~~
../../devel/qemu/target/ppc/spr_common.h:77:5: note: in expansion of macro
‘spr_register_kvm’
77 | spr_register_kvm(env, num, name, uea_read, uea_write,
\
| ^~~~~~~~~~~~~~~~
../../devel/qemu/target/ppc/cpu_init.c:894:9: note: in expansion of macro
‘spr_register’
894 | spr_register(env, SPR_BOOKE_TLB3CFG, "TLB3CFG",
| ^~~~~~~~~~~~
../../devel/qemu/target/ppc/cpu_init.c: In function ‘init_proc_e500’:
../../devel/qemu/target/ppc/cpu_init.c:2809:14: note: at offset 12 into object
‘tlbncfg’ of size 8
2809 | uint32_t tlbncfg[2];
| ^~~~~~~
cc1: all warnings being treated as errors
init_proc_e500() only defines "uint32_t tlbncfg[2];", but it is OK since
it also sets "env->nb_ways = 2", so the code that GCC warns about in
register_BookE206_sprs() is never reached. Unfortunately, GCC is not smart
enough to see this, so it emits these warnings.
To fix it, let's simplify the code in register_BookE206_sprs() a little
bit to set up the SPRs in a loop, so we don't reference the tlbncfg[3]
entry directly anymore.
